Tube forming is the process of shaping metal tubes into the desired size and shape through various manufacturing techniques. This process is used to create seamless and welded tubes that are used in a multitude of applications.
Tube forming can be done through several methods, including seamless tube forming, welded tube forming, and bending. Each method has its advantages and is chosen based on the specific requirements of the product being manufactured. Seamless tube forming is a popular method used in industries where a high level of precision and strength is required. This process involves heating a metal billet and then piercing it to form a tube. The seamless tubes produced through this method are known for their durability and smooth surface finish.
On the other hand, welded tube forming is a cost-effective method that is commonly used in industries where large quantities of tubes are needed. This process involves welding two edges of a strip of metal to form a tube. While welded tubes may not be as strong as seamless tubes, they are more affordable and can be produced in larger quantities. Welded tubes are commonly used in construction, furniture making, and automotive industries.
Another important aspect of tube forming is bending. Bending allows manufacturers to create tubes in various shapes and sizes, making them suitable for specific applications. The bending process involves using a machine to bend a tube around a die to achieve the desired curvature. Bending is commonly used in industries such as furniture making, automotive, and HVAC systems.
